Freight Preparation Guide

Prepare Your Shipment for Pickup 


Proper freight preparation helps support accurate quoting, efficient pickup, and smoother transportation. Before scheduling your shipment with Uptown Express, make sure the key shipment details and handling requirements are available.


Provide Accurate Shipment Information


Have the following information ready:

  • Pickup and delivery locations
  • Description of the freight
  • Number of pallets, crates, or pieces
  • Packaged dimensions
  • Total shipment weight
  • Requested pickup date
  • Required delivery date, if applicable

Accurate shipment details help determine the appropriate service, equipment, and transportation requirements.


Prepare and Secure Your Freight


Freight should be properly packaged and secured before pickup. Depending on the shipment, this may include palletizing, crating, wrapping, strapping, or other protective preparation.


The shipment should be stable, clearly labeled, and ready for loading when the driver arrives.


Identify Special Service Requirements


Notify Uptown Express in advance if your shipment requires additional services or equipment, such as:

  • Liftgate service
  • Inside pickup or delivery
  • Appointment scheduling
  • Specialized equipment
  • White Glove handling
  • Oversized or heavy haul transportation
  • Limited-access pickup or delivery

Providing these details before scheduling helps ensure the proper transportation arrangements are made.


Be Ready for Scheduled Pickup


Before pickup, confirm that the freight is fully prepared, accessible, and ready to load. Someone should be available at the pickup location when required to provide access, documentation, or loading assistance.
